
Children’s minds and their way of thinking often amaze even adults. A similar incident happened recently in Kerala. Upset after being scolded by his mother, a second-grade student decided to leave home!
The little boy intended to go straight to the police station to file a complaint against his mother. However, not knowing the way, he mistakenly ended up at a fire station instead! The fire department officers were initially puzzled but patiently listened to the child's grievance.
"My mother scolds me a lot! I don’t want to go back home!"—the child declared loudly, filing his "complaint."
Understanding the amusing yet heartbreaking situation, the firefighters first comforted the boy. They later traced his family and safely escorted him back home.
